2022

A year of new beginnings, 2022 saw Al Jeri Investment enter the automotive sector with the launch of JCS-Bosch and Shaheen Rent-a-car.

2021

The Al Jeri Group begins F&B operations with 45degrees cafe and the  chain of convenience stores.

2020

Secured key delivery contracts for petroleum products with Aramco, military facilities, SABIC, and Rally Dakar. J:Oil opens its 50th petrol station.

2019

Jeri Energy is launched in partnership with an Indian company.

2018

Now sporting a fleet of 1250 tucks and 3000 trailers, JTC is ideally placed to start operating in the water transport sector.

1995

The Al Jeri Group moves into real estate, while JTC hits 300 trucks, 750 trailers.

1992

Entering asphalt transportation stretches the company further, as JTC’s fleet grows to 100 trucks and 250 trailers.

1990

JTC grows further, reaching 30 trucks and 75 trailers.

1989

JTC expands to 10 trucks, 25 trailers, and the first J:Oil petrol station is opened.

1988

Al Jeri Transport Company was founded with one truck
